About the area
Port Aransas, Texas, affectionately known as "Port A" by locals, is a charming beach town nestled on the northern tip of Mustang Island. This coastal haven is a paradise for beach lovers, anglers, and anyone looking to escape into a laid-back island atmosphere.
The town's crown jewel is its miles of soft, sandy beaches that stretch along the warm waters of the Gulf of Mexico. These beaches are perfect for sunbathing, building sandcastles, or simply taking a leisurely stroll while listening to the soothing sounds of the waves. For the more adventurous, the waters off Port Aransas offer excellent opportunities for surfing, kiteboarding, and parasailing.
Anglers will find Port Aransas to be a world-class fishing destination, with options ranging from surf fishing to deep-sea excursions. The town is known for its numerous fishing tournaments throughout the year, including the Deep Sea Roundup, the oldest fishing tournament on the Gulf Coast.
Nature enthusiasts will appreciate the area's rich biodiversity, which can be explored at the Port Aransas Nature Preserve. The preserve features boardwalks and observation towers for bird watching, as well as trails for hiking and wildlife spotting. The nearby Leonabelle Turnbull Birding Center is another hotspot for birders, with hundreds of species passing through during migration seasons.
For a dose of history and culture, visitors can explore the Port Aransas Museum or take a trip to the historic Lydia Ann Lighthouse. The town also boasts a vibrant arts scene, with galleries and shops showcasing the work of local artists and craftsmen.
